Our Approach to Town Planning in Noosa
• Site Feasibility & Risk Analysis
We start by reviewing the Noosa Plan 2020, zoning maps, overlay constraints such as flood risk, biodiversity areas, bushfire hazards, and infrastructure capacity. This upfront analysis gives you a clear understanding of what is possible and highlights any hurdles early.
• Application Preparation & Lodgement
From a Reconfiguration of a Lot for rural acreage in Kin Kin to a Material Change of Use for a small café in Tewantin or a multi‑dwelling application near Hastings Street, we prepare well‑considered applications and lodge them with Noosa Council on your behalf.
• Council Liaison & Negotiation
Early and open engagement is crucial in Noosa. We coordinate pre‑lodgement meetings, respond to council officer feedback, and negotiate conditions to avoid unnecessary delays and keep your project moving forward.
• Post‑Approval Compliance & Title Registration
Once approval is granted, we manage all compliance steps — from service connections and stormwater management to bushfire mitigation and landscaping, ensuring titles for you and are issued, helping your project get ready for construction.


Can Your Property Be Developed or Subdivided?
Noosa’s planning framework is known for protecting its natural assets. Projects must address factors such as bushfire overlays in Cootharaba, flooding risks near the river, vegetation clearing restrictions, and infrastructure availability. Whether you are planning an infill subdivision in Sunshine Beach, a set of townhouses in Tewantin, or a commercial upgrade near Noosa Civic, our feasibility assessment identifies opportunities and flags any red flags before you commit too much time or money.
